About N-[2-(2-methylpiperidin-1-yl)ethyl]-2-thiophen-3-yl-1,3-thiazole-5-carboxamide
N-[2-(2-methylpiperidin-1-yl)ethyl]-2-thiophen-3-yl-1,3-thiazole-5-carboxamide (PubChem CID 75463616) has the molecular formula C16H21N3OS2
and a molecular weight of 335.50 g/mol. Its IUPAC name is N-[2-(2-methylpiperidin-1-yl)ethyl]-2-thiophen-3-yl-1,3-thiazole-5-carboxamide.

What is the SMILES notation for N-[2-(2-methylpiperidin-1-yl)ethyl]-2-thiophen-3-yl-1,3-thiazole-5-carboxamide?
The canonical SMILES for N-[2-(2-methylpiperidin-1-yl)ethyl]-2-thiophen-3-yl-1,3-thiazole-5-carboxamide is CC1CCCCN1CCNC(=O)c1cnc(-c2ccsc2)s1.
What is the InChIKey of N-[2-(2-methylpiperidin-1-yl)ethyl]-2-thiophen-3-yl-1,3-thiazole-5-carboxamide?
The InChIKey is HFTHRPRUCAPDPN-UHFFFAOYSA-N. The full InChI is InChI=1S/C16H21N3OS2/c1-12-4-2-3-7-19(12)8-6-17-15(20)14-10-18-16(22-14)13-5-9-21-11-13/h5,9-12H,2-4,6-8H2,1H3,(H,17,20).
What are the key properties of N-[2-(2-methylpiperidin-1-yl)ethyl]-2-thiophen-3-yl-1,3-thiazole-5-carboxamide?
N-[2-(2-methylpiperidin-1-yl)ethyl]-2-thiophen-3-yl-1,3-thiazole-5-carboxamide has a molecular weight of 335.50 g/mol, XLogP of 3.48, 5 rotatable bonds, 1 hydrogen bond donors, and 5 hydrogen bond acceptors.
